Local Port of Port Phillip

Mornington

Fishermans Beach - West Cardinal Mark Buoy Remediation Works

Date:

28 May 2024

Details:

Mariners are advised of remediation works utilising a piling barge to remove and re-establish the West Cardinal Mark Buoy with characteristics VQ (9)10s, situated off Fisherman’s Beach at approximate location 38°13.417'S, 145°01.584'E (WGS84).

Works will be undertaken on 28 May 2024.

Mariners are advised to navigate with caution in the vicinity of the works and
requested to avoid wake and wash within 100m of the vessels undertaking work.

Charts & Publications Affected:

AUS143
